Output 622138c5ef6adc98a1f52dd68f404ae8820c50f0ec77cfb6c589d3822be94f9a:0

value
12447255
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7527ed569cb36fcb18fe91db79df4431e6d61c00 OP_EQUAL
address
MJad84KfEghs4MjXeigzbbm2SEcGiexUwo
transaction
622138c5ef6adc98a1f52dd68f404ae8820c50f0ec77cfb6c589d3822be94f9a
spent
true